Featuring a former superstar on the same cover as B-grade films with suggestive titles like ANGADAEE (which means "stretching" or "yawning") and EK BAAR DHOL BAJAO NA was considered scandalous. The packaging placed Rajesh Khanna amidst images of women in revealing attire, forcing the actor into a "new zone" that many of his fans found disappointing.

In the vast, vibrant, and often bewildering history of Indian cinema, certain titles possess a peculiar power—they stop you dead in your tracks, make you do a double-take, and leave you scratching your head, wondering, "Did I read that right?" "Ek Baar Dhol Bajao Na" is one such title. This phrase, which translates roughly to "Please play the drums once, won't you?" is not the name of an obscure indie art film or a regional folk opera. Instead, it is a real Bollywood film, and one that occupies a unique, almost legendary, space in the annals of Indian pop culture.
